The Diversity and Richness of Vietnamese Handicrafts

Vietnam is renowned for its long-standing tradition of diverse and rich handicrafts. From famous traditional craft villages like Bat Trang pottery, Dong Ho paintings, Phu Xuyen wood carving to other exquisite handicrafts such as embroidery, weaving, silver, and gemstones, each region possesses its unique characteristics, reflecting the nation’s culture and history. The skill, meticulousness, and dedication of artisans are clearly evident in each product, creating unique artistic and cultural value.

Traditional Craft Villages: Preserving the Soul of Culture

Traditional craft villages play a crucial role in preserving and developing Vietnamese handicrafts. Here, traditional techniques are preserved and promoted through generations, creating unique products with historical value. Visiting these villages is not only a fascinating cultural experience but also contributes to supporting and developing the local economy.

Famous Craft Villages:

  • Bat Trang Pottery (Hanoi): Famous for high-quality ceramic products, diverse in designs and styles.
  • Dong Ho Paintings (Bac Ninh): Vivid folk paintings depicting the daily life of Vietnamese people.
  • Phu Xuyen Wood Carving (Hanoi): Exquisite wood carvings showcasing the talent and skill of artisans.
  • Ninh Binh Embroidery: Delicate embroidery products with unique patterns and bright colors.

Economic Opportunities from Handicrafts

Handicrafts are not only a cultural heritage but also a significant economic resource. With the development of tourism and e-commerce, Vietnamese handicrafts are becoming increasingly well-known worldwide. Combining tradition and modernity to create products that meet international market demands will open up many economic opportunities for people and craft villages.

Preservation and Development of Handicrafts

To preserve and develop Vietnamese handicrafts, attention and investment from multiple sources are needed. Vocational training, financial support, trade promotion, and intellectual property protection are crucial factors for the sustainable development of this industry. Moreover, raising community awareness of the value of handicrafts is essential to maintain and develop this traditional craft.
